Carol Freeman Photography Inc

Closed

Photos

2516 Waukegan Rd
Glenview, IL 60025

Carol Freeman Photography Inc, located in Glenview, IL, offers a diverse range of photography products, including greeting cards, holiday cards, bookmarks, matted prints, and nature-themed trading cards. The company recently launched a new online store featuring the 2014 "In Beauty I Walk" calendar among other unique items.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esIllinoisGlenviewCarol Freeman Photography Inc

Partial Data by Infogroup (c) 2025. All rights reserved.

Partial Data by Foursquare.